However, in classic Apharan style, nothing is as it seems. What starts as a straightforward extraction mission spirals into a complex web of betrayal involving the underworld, the police force, and a sinister mastermind. The season explores themes of redemption and entrapment, asking the question: Can a man who has made a career out of lying and cheating ever truly escape his past? The soul of the series remains Arunoday Singh. His portrayal of Rudra is a refreshing departure from the typical "hero cop." Rudra is flawed, impulsive, selfish, yet strangely charismatic. He gets beaten up, makes terrible decisions, and often survives purely on luck and wit. Singh leans into these imperfections, making the character incredibly watchable.

For fans of gritty Indian crime thrillers, 2022 brought a much-anticipated return to the chaotic world of Rudra Srivastava. , the sequel to the wildly popular 2018 series, dropped as a completed package, offering a binge-worthy experience that doubles down on the twists, dark humor, and moral ambiguity that made the first season a hit. The Plot: Bigger Stakes, Deeper Trouble Picking up after the events of the first season, Season 2 finds the disgraced yet crafty inspector Rudra Srivastava (played by Arunoday Singh) in a new milieu, but old habits die hard. The narrative shifts from the hills of Uttarakhand to the bustling, dangerous streets of Mumbai (and later international waters), where Rudra is embroiled in a high-profile kidnapping case involving a young girl.
The supporting cast adds significant flavor to the mix. Nidhi Singh returns as Ranjana, providing a grounded counterpoint to Rudra’s chaos. However, Season 2 also introduces compelling new antagonists. The "Sid" storyline and the ruthless villainy of Laxman (Saanand Verma) provide the necessary tension to drive the plot forward. Unlike many Indian police procedurals that take themselves too seriously, Apharan embraces a pulpy, almost retro-thriller vibe. The direction by Santosh Singh ensures the pacing is breakneck. Because the series was released as "completed," viewers can enjoy the satisfaction of a full narrative arc without the agonizing wait of weekly cliffhangers.
